| 241 | /*=* |
|---|
| 242 | A Display provides control of a video compositor. |
|---|
| 243 | |
|---|
| 244 | Each display has one or more video windows. |
|---|
| 245 | For all displays except NEXUS_DisplayType_eBypass types, there is one graphics framebuffer. |
|---|
| 246 | The compositor combines these video sources into one display. |
|---|
| 247 | |
|---|
| 248 | For NEXUS_DisplayType_eAuto types, there is a VEC associated with the compositor for analog output. |
|---|
| 249 | |
|---|
| 250 | NEXUS_VideoInput tokens are connected to NEXUS_VideoWindowHandle's to route from various video sources. |
|---|
| 251 | See NEXUS_VideoWindow_AddInput. |
|---|
| 252 | |
|---|
| 253 | NEXUS_VideoOutput tokens are added to NEXUS_Display to route to various video outputs. |
|---|
| 254 | See NEXUS_Display_AddOutput. |
|---|
| 255 | **/ |

| 329 | /** |
|---|
| 330 | Summary: |
|---|
| 331 | This type describes possible update modes for the display module |
|---|
| 332 | |
|---|
| 333 | Description: |
|---|
| 334 | When updating the display, it's often necessary to call multiple functions to get the |
|---|
| 335 | desired setting. Instead of having each function applied immediately to hardware, the user can instruct Nexus |
|---|
| 336 | to accumulate changes, then apply them all at once. |
|---|
| 337 | |
|---|
| 338 | By default Nexus operates in NEXUS_DisplayUpdateMode_eAuto mode. In this mode, all changes |
|---|
| 339 | are applied immediately and do not accumulate. |
|---|
| 340 | |
|---|
| 341 | If you set Nexus into NEXUS_DisplayUpdateMode_eManual mode, changes will accumulate. |
|---|
| 342 | Call NEXUS_DisplayModule_SetUpdateMode(NEXUS_DisplayUpdateMode_eNow) to apply the |
|---|
| 343 | acculumated changes. Nexus will remain in NEXUS_DisplayUpdateMode_eManual mode. |
|---|
| 344 | |
|---|
| 345 | Be aware that some changes cannot be accumulated, even in NEXUS_DisplayUpdateMode_eManual mode. |
|---|
| 346 | These will be applied immediately, as if it was in NEXUS_DisplayUpdateMode_eAuto mode. |
|---|
| 347 | This mainly applies to creation and destruction of resources. |
|---|
| 348 | **/ |
|---|
| 349 | typedef enum NEXUS_DisplayUpdateMode |
|---|
| 350 | { |
|---|
| 351 | NEXUS_DisplayUpdateMode_eAuto, /* Update the display settings immediately. */ |
|---|
| 352 | NEXUS_DisplayUpdateMode_eManual, /* Accumulate changes until user calls NEXUS_DisplayModule_SetUpdateMode(NEXUS_DisplayUpdateMode_eNow) */ |
|---|
| 353 | NEXUS_DisplayUpdateMode_eNow /* Apply all changes accumulated in NEXUS_DisplayUpdateMode_eManual mode. */ |
|---|
| 354 | } NEXUS_DisplayUpdateMode; |
|---|
| 355 | |
|---|
| 356 | /** |
|---|
| 357 | Summary: |
|---|
| 358 | This function is used to control when changes in display settings take effect. |
|---|
| 359 | |
|---|
| 360 | Description: |
|---|
| 361 | Most display module functions take effect immediately (e.g. resizing of a window). |
|---|
| 362 | NEXUS_DisplayModule_SetUpdateMode allows the user to accumulate changes and commit them as a single transaction. |
|---|
| 363 | This can reduce execution time and can eliminate transition effects. |
|---|
| 364 | |
|---|
| 365 | For example to change size of two windows simultaneously user would need use this code: |
|---|
| 366 | |
|---|
| 367 | NEXUS_DisplayModule_SetUpdateMode(NEXUS_DisplayUpdateMode_eManual); |
|---|
| 368 | NEXUS_VideoWindow_GetSettings(window0, &windowSettings); |
|---|
| 369 | windowSettings.position.height /= 2; |
|---|
| 370 | windowSettings.position.width /= 2; |
|---|
| 371 | NEXUS_VideoWindow_SetSettings(window0, &windowSettings); |
|---|
| 372 | NEXUS_VideoWindow_GetSettings(window1, &windowSettings); |
|---|
| 373 | windowSettings.position.height *= 2; |
|---|
| 374 | windowSettings.position.width *= 2; |
|---|
| 375 | NEXUS_VideoWindow_SetSettings(window1, &windowSettings); |
|---|
| 376 | NEXUS_DisplayModule_SetUpdateMode(NEXUS_DisplayUpdateMode_eAuto); |
|---|
| 377 | **/ |
|---|
| 378 | NEXUS_Error NEXUS_DisplayModule_SetUpdateMode( |
|---|
| 379 | NEXUS_DisplayUpdateMode updateMode |
|---|
| 380 | ); |

| 569 | /* |
|---|
| 570 | Summary: |
|---|
| 571 | Set which surface should be used as the framebuffer. |
|---|
| 572 | |
|---|
| 573 | Description: |
|---|
| 574 | There is no implicit double-buffering. The user is responsible to provide any double or triple buffering logic by cycling the framebuffer between two or three surfaces. |
|---|
| 575 | |
|---|
| 576 | If you are doing asynchronous blits into the new framebuffer, to avoid tearing your app must wait for those blits to be completed before calling |
|---|
| 577 | NEXUS_Display_SetGraphicsFramebuffer. See NEXUS_Graphics2D_Checkpoint. |
|---|
| 578 | |
|---|
| 579 | The framebuffer will be switched on the next vsync. NEXUS_GraphicsSettings.frameBufferCallback will be fired after that switch happens. |
|---|
| 580 | If you are double buffering, to avoid tearing you must not write into the outgoing framebuffer until after frameBufferCallback is fired. |
|---|
| 581 | If you want to start updating the next framebuffer before waiting for frameBufferCallback, use triple buffering. You can achieve a sustained 60 fps |
|---|
| 582 | graphics update (or 50 fps for 50Hz systems), if your application can prepare the next framebuffer in less than the 16 msec vsync time minus a small amount |
|---|
| 583 | of time (e.g. 1-2 msec) to process the frameBufferCallback. |
|---|
| 584 | |
|---|
| 585 | If you call NEXUS_Display_SetGraphicsFramebuffer a second time, before the first call was able to be applied (i.e. before the next vsync), your first call |
|---|
| 586 | will be overwritten. NEXUS_Display_SetGraphicsFramebuffer calls are not queued. |
|---|
| 587 | |
|---|
| 588 | Framebuffers are always placed at coordinate 0,0. |
|---|
| 589 | |
|---|
| 590 | The difference between this surface's width and height and the NEXUS_GraphicsSettings destinationWidth and destinationHeight will |
|---|
| 591 | result in graphics feeder scaling, if the scaling feature exists. |
|---|
| 592 | |
|---|
| 593 | When you set NEXUS_GraphicsSettings.enabled = false, nexus will forget about any framebuffer that was set. The application can then |
|---|
| 594 | safely delete the surface. To re-enable, you must set NEXUS_GraphicsSettings.enabled = true and call NEXUS_Display_SetGraphicsFramebuffer with a new surface. |
|---|
| 595 | */ |
